Description

The IEEE Power & Energy Society Student Branch Chapter of the University of Ruhuna, in collaboration with the Power Circle of the Electrical and Information Engineering Society (EIES) for the term 2025/2026, is planning to organise Voltcast 2.0, a practical power engineering workshop series and design challenge aimed at enhancing the technical knowledge and industrial readiness of undergraduate students. Voltcast 2.0 is designed to provide participants with hands-on exposure to low-voltage electrical installation design, lighting design, electrical layouts, and power system analysis through a structured series of technical workshops and a final engineering design challenge. The program combines theoretical learning with practical software-based applications using industry-relevant tools such as DIALux, Revit, and ETAP, enabling participants to develop practical engineering and problem-solving skills aligned with modern industry requirements. Objectives ● To provide practical exposure to low-voltage electrical installation design. ● To bridge theoretical electrical engineering concepts with industrial applications. ● To improve technical knowledge in load calculation, cable selection, and protection system design. The VoltCast 2.0 Final Event concluded with an exciting competition that showcased the technical knowledge, problem-solving abilities, and practical power system analysis skills of the participating teams. After a series of challenging assessments based on ETAP and DIALux , Team ElectraX emerged as the Champions , demonstrating exceptional technical competence and outstanding overall performance. Team PowerX secured the 1st Runner-Up position with an impressive performance throughout the competition, while Team Arc Brigade earned the 2nd Runner-Up title for their remarkable analytical and practical skills.
